The Role of Brain-Derived Neurotrophic Factor in Bone Marrow Stromal Cell-Mediated Spinal Cord Repair

The ability of intraspinal bone marrow stromal cell (BMSC) transplants to elicit repair is thought to result from paracrine effects by secreted trophic factors including brain-derived neurotrophic factor (BDNF).
